Godzilla Singular Point (2021)

Review by worksmart-58506

Godzilla Singular Point

4/10

Why is it called Godzilla?

Yet another program with Godzilla in the title but not in the actual program. They introduce 'something' in ep 7 that they call Godzilla, only it looks nothing like Godzilla. Admittedly i haven't watched further yet and might not, because it's been a complete snore fest filled with the same tired old writing and annoying characters. The whiny AI, voiced by the same actress who seemingly does every AI, robot and machine character to add a childish quality to all these shows, makes me happy it's easy to fast forward on Netflix. I definitely would have preferred if this show had been taken a little more seriously pre-development. There's more than enough science and intellectualism to write it as a dramatic mystery. The forced comic relief just brings it down. I'm hoping it will get better, but not holding my breath.

Edit: so from ep 8, Godzilla does indeed look like Godzilla, and he's pretty awesome. At least that's done well. Ofc you only get to see him for 1 minute in the next 4 episodes combined.
